Bedroom Water Removal Cost In Norwood, MA

The cost of bedroom water removal can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500. Factors that affect cost include the size of the affected area, the type of water damage, and the level of repair required.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ate for your bedroom water removal need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of the affected area, type of water damage
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, level of repair required
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$3,000 Size of the affected area, level of repair required
Final inspection and cleaning $200 – $500 Size of the affected area, level of repair required
